The Madness Balam 245 is a reference floating swimbait for anglers hunting trophy predators. With its large dimensions and multi-segment articulated design, it perfectly reproduces the swim of a big baitfish, making it an ideal lure for pike and large black bass. Its rigid ABS resin body combined with a silicone tail provides strength, flexibility and realism, even after multiple strikes.
Developed by Madness in collaboration with Japanese specialist Satan Shimada, the Balam 245 follows the legendary Balam 300 while offering a more manageable size for many fishing situations. This articulated swimbait is built to withstand very high retrieve speeds: it stays stable, producing a wide, vibrating swim that can trigger reflex strikes from following or inactive fish.
Conversely, it also excels on slow retrieves as a classic swimbait, producing a broad, seductive undulation. This dual ability makes the Balam 245 an extremely versatile lure, effective both for fast prospecting and for methodical approaches in high-pressure fishing areas.
The main asset of the Balam 245 lies in its ultra-realistic swim. The combination of its four-segment body and silicone tail creates a wide, fluid and continuous movement that faithfully imitates an injured or fleeing baitfish. This visual realism is amplified by a significant water displacement, allowing the lure to be detected from afar by predators, even in slightly stained water.
Its ability to sustain very high-speed retrieves is another decisive strength. Where many swimbaits fail or lose efficiency, the Balam 245 remains stable and fishable. This trait enables reflex strikes from following fish, often reluctant to bite slower presentations. Alternating fast phases and pauses can provoke brutal and spectacular reactions.
Conversely, the lure performs equally well on slow animations. Used on a steady retrieve or with intermittent pauses, it keeps an attractive swim, perfectly suited to wary fish or high-pressure conditions. The Balam 245 thus offers true animation versatility, making it a valuable tool to adapt to predator behaviour throughout the day.
Finally, its factory rigging with Decoy treble hooks size 2/0 ensures excellent hook sets and reduces drops. Anglers thus get a ready-to-fish lure without immediate modifications, which is appreciated for a swimbait of this category.
To get the best from the Madness Balam 245, use a powerful casting or spinning setup with a rod offering good backbone and a reliable reel. A braided mainline paired with a leader suitable for pike teeth secures fights with the largest specimens. Make sure to set the drag properly to handle the violent strikes typical of swimbait attacks.
When prospecting, start with fast, steady retrieves to cover water and assess fish activity. Don’t hesitate to add short accelerations or cadence changes to amplify the fleeing-prey effect. If predators follow without committing, progressively slow down to a slow or semi-static presentation, focusing on marked areas (breaks, shallows, weed edges).
In heavily fished waters, vary swim depths by changing retrieve speed and rod angle. The Balam 245, being a floating swimbait, allows you to run along edges, skim over weeds or explore deeper zones while maintaining a natural action. Always adapt your presentation to season, water temperature and fish mood to maximize this exceptional lure’s potential.
Question 1 : Is the Madness Balam 245 only suitable for expert anglers?
Answer: Although highly appreciated by swimbait specialists, the Balam 245 remains accessible to intermediate anglers. Its swim is effective with simple straight retrieves, and it handles both slow and fast animations, allowing anyone to successfully target large predators.
